0

我有一个时髦的问题 - 给定 urihttp://localhost和相对文件路径virtualdirectory\\path\\to\\my\\file.html,我怎样才能将它们合并到一个应该是有效的 Url 中http://localhost/virtualdirectory/path/to/my/file.html

我正在使用 Web.API 和客户端搜索来查看服务器上的虚拟目录中是否存在静态 html 文件。客户端使用 jQuery 请求搜索,Web.API 控制器在本地虚拟目录上进行搜索。如果文件确实存在,控制器需要向客户端返回一个有效的 Url,以便客户端可以查看该静态 html 文件。

如果这是有道理的。:)

4

1 回答 1

1
new Uri(new Uri("http://localhost/"), "virtualdirectory\\path\\to\\my\\file.html".Replace("\\","/"));
于 2013-02-12T18:47:18.093 回答